Product instruction
- Camera (optional): 2M pixel camera
- LED Indicator:
- Red: System is booting.
- Green: System is working properly.
- Light Off: Power supply is off
- SD Card Slot / Cover: support external SD card
- Escape Button: return to the previous page
- Function Keys (Up / Down): select the up/down item
- Function Keys (Vol+ / Vol-): adjust the system volume
- Escape Button: return to the previous page
- Function Keys (Up / Down): select the up/down
- DC In Jack: powered by 12V/2A DC input
- Ethernet RJ45 Port: support Ethernet connection (10/100Mbps LAN)
- USB Port: support USB 2.0 high speed 480Mbps
- Micro-USB Port: support USB 2.0 high speed 480Mbps
- Power Switch: switch power ON/OFF
- Add-on module slot: to put optional add-on module
- Headset + Microphone Jack
- WIFI: 802.11blg/n/ac 2.4G
- Temperature:
- Operation: 0’C 40C ( 32F -104F)
- Storage:-10°C 55°C (14°F~ 131°F)

Power on the Product
Step1 Power on the power adapter that connected to this product.
Step2 Switch the power switch (#13 in Product Instruction) on the back of this
product to ON.
-
Insert SD Card
This product supports external SD card. Please insert your SD card into the SD Card Slot (#3 in Product Instruction) on the top of this product. -
Insert USB Devices
This product supports USB and Micro-USB to deal with your files. -
USB
Plug your USB memory into the USB port (#11 in Product Instruction) on the bottom of this product, and then you can do the file operations via the File Browser. (See the details in Browse Files). -
Micro-USB
Connect the Micro-USB port (#12 in Product Instruction) on the bottom of this product and the USB port on your computer with a Micro-USB-to-USB cable. Click the “Turn on USB storage” button in the “USB mass storage” window that pops up automatically to make the device memory visible in your computer.

Date & Time
In the App list, click “Settings” to open the system setting app, and select the option “Date & time”
If you enabled the option “Automatic date & time” under “Date & time”,
system date and time will be synchronized automatically with network time when
you connected a Wi-Fi network.
If you want to set the time manually, you need to disable “Automatic date &
time”.
In this option, you can also set time zone, time notation and date format.

Wi-Fi
In the App list, click “Settings” to open the system setting app, and select the option “Wi-Fi”.
Switch the Wi-Fi button to ON. The product will scan available wireless networks automatically. Select a network under Wi-Fi networks and input the password to connect.
Ethernet
In the App list, click “Settings” to open the system setting app, and select the option “Ethernet”.
Switch the Ethernet button to ON and plug the Internet cable into the Ethernet port (#10 in Product Instruction). If you are Static IP user, please set the configurations manually.

Reset to Factory Default
Please make sure to back up the important data before resetting the device.
In the App list, click “Settings” to open the system setting app, and select the option “Backup & reset”
Click “Factory data reset”.
Click “Reset tablet” button.
Click “Erase everything” button, and then waiting system reboots and resets to factory default.
